  1. Lawrence Thomas Murphy (born March 8, 1961) is a Canadian former professional ice hockey defenceman. He played over 20 years in the National Hockey League, suiting up for the Los Angeles Kings, Washington Capitals, Minnesota North Stars, Pittsburgh Penguins, Toronto Maple Leafs, and Detroit Red Wings.

  4. Murphy holds the NHL record for points (76) and assists (60) by a rookie defenseman. Larry ranks 5th all time in scoring by a defenseman, totaling 1,217 points over his 21-year career. Murphy is also a 4x Stanley Cup Champion, winning 2 with Pittsburgh and 2 with Detroit.
